## Overview

Athene Holding Ltd. declared third quarter 2026 preferred stock dividends, a routine financial action with no AI or technology relevance.

### TL;DR

- Athene announced preferred stock dividend payments for Q3 2026.
- Dividends are non-cumulative and tied to depositary shares representing fractional interests in preferred stock.
- Payment date is September 30, 2026; record date is September 15, 2026.
